Quote:
Originally Posted by terp_fan99 View Post
Yea, under the BCS system which clearly didn't always get it right. If we were still using the BCS system, neither Oregon or Ohio State would have made the championship and Alabama probably would have destroyed Florida State giving the overrated SEC yet another title.

Just shows how flawed that system was at picking the supposed best teams. I don't even think we got the best four teams this year. They need to expand the playoffs for sure, only way they are guaranteed to get all the top teams in there without computers or committees screwing it up.
You don't have to tell me the system blows. I've despised the BCS system since it's inception in 1998 and I still don't like the 4 team system. I'm looking forward to the inevitable 8 team playoff. That being said it is what it is. National champions are determined by the system we have rather than the system we want. The teams that won in the BCS era were national champions. Hell, when I was a teenager I remember the pre-BCS era which was even worse since there was no title game of any kind and we frequently had co-champions.

Considering how lethargic Bama was today it's entirely possible even FSU may have beaten them if it were the old top-2 format.

Quote:
Originally Posted by terp_fan99 View Post
Okay, glad we're on the same page then! I hope you're right about the 8 team playoff, but considering how long it's taken college football to get anywhere near a fair system, I don't see it happening anytime soon.
It won't be quick. The United States Congress acts faster than the college football playoff system. It took like 70+ years just to get a national title game and another 17 years to expand to 4 teams. I'd be shocked if an 8 team playoff develops any sooner than 5-10 years. But it'll happen... eventually.
